  • Abstract
    In the studied micro pump, magnetic micro beads have been used for both pumping and valving purposes. Micro beads, which have been concentrated and actuated magnetically, fill the cross section of the channel of the micro pump. Movement of the magnetic field in any direction causes the micro beads to move in the same direction, so the micro beads can pump the fluid. Current carrying structures have been used to produce a magnetic field. The performance of the micro pump directly depends on the frequency of application of the current to the current carrying structures. In this paper, in order to improve the performance of the micro pump, study of the effect of frequency has been presented. For simulations, COMSOL 3.5a has been used.
